HCT is most often evaluated as part of a CBC, which also includes measurements of RBC, WBC, platelets, and … WebPV decreased within hours, resulting in an increased total body hematocrit during the first few days of the mission. Serum erythropoietin level decreased within 24 hours and remained low. Circulating RBCs disappeared at a normal rate during flight, but few new cells replaced those destroyed, resulting in a decrease in RBCM of 11% during the mission.

Web11 okt. 2024 · An EPO test is usually ordered in follow up to abnormal results on a complete blood count (CBC), such as a low red blood cell (RBC) count and low hemoglobin and hematocrit. These tests help diagnose anemia and give the health care practitioner clues as to the likely cause of the anemia. Specifically, males have about 5.4 million erythrocytes per microliter ( µ L) of blood, and females have approximately 4.8 million per µ L. hogminet new year edinburghWeb4 mrt. 2024 · Microcytic: MCV level below 80 fL. Normocytic: MCV level between 80 and 100 fL. Macrocytic: MCV level above 100 fL. A low or high MCV level may indicate health issues.
